These bugs feed... WebSpider droppings, in general, are dark, semi-liquid, and squishy that it resembles a paint splatter. Considering the omnivorous diet of a spider, its poop can have shades of black, brown, white, or grey. The exact shade of its poop may vary with respect to the spider species, but in general, you can expect dark splats or drips.

Insect and reptilian pests will be found in hard to reach areas, within walls, and underneath plants or porches. WebClover mites are very tiny as can be seen on this ruler. The mites are very tiny creatures (smaller than a pin head) and may occur in countless numbers. They usually appear first around windows, but later may overrun entire walls of a home. To most people they appear as tiny, moving, black specks. WebYou will see scatterings of frass near termite infestations. Black citrus aphids (Toxoptera aurantii) and black peach aphids (Brachycaudus persicae) feed in colonies on flowers and leaves. At first glance, these tiny, black bugs look like poppy seeds to the naked eye.
